How To Choose The Best 10 Round Carpet

Not all 10-foot round carpets perform the same. A rug that looks stunning in a listing photo can shed constantly, bunch up under your dining table, or trap every crumb and pet hair. Focus on four factors that actually determine whether a round carpet fits your room and your lifestyle.

Pile Height and Texture

The distance from the backing to the top of the fibers — the pile height — is the single most important spec. Low-pile carpets (0.2 to 0.35 inches) work best under dining tables and in entryways because chairs glide smoothly and robot vacuums can climb over the edge. Mid-pile options (0.4 to 0.6 inches) offer a balance of softness and practicality. High-pile shag rugs (2+ inches) deliver a luxurious feel but trap debris and block most vacuum cleaners. Decide where the rug will live before choosing the pile.

Backing Material and Non-Slip Performance

The backing is what keeps a 10-foot round rug stationary. Rubber or TPR (thermoplastic rubber) backings grip hardwood, tile, and laminate floors firmly without a separate pad. Jute or cotton backings are more breathable and eco-friendly but tend to slide on smooth surfaces — these usually require a rug pad underneath. If the rug will sit in a high-traffic area or a home with kids and pets, a rubber-backed model is the safer choice.

Washability and Maintenance

A 10-foot round rug is heavy — some weigh over 60 pounds. Machine washability is a valuable feature, but you need to check the fine print: most washable polyester rugs in this size require a commercial laundromat because they won’t fit in a standard home washer. Flatweave constructions are easier to hose down outdoors, while high-pile shags need professional cleaning. Polypropylene rugs can be spot-cleaned with mild detergent and vacuumed regularly without special treatment.

Construction and Fiber Type

Machine-made polypropylene is the most common fiber in this category because it resists stains, shedding, and fading. Handwoven cotton or jute rugs offer a natural, textured look but are more prone to staining and shedding. The construction method — braided, flatweave, or tufted — also affects longevity. Braided rugs are exceptionally durable but take time to flatten after shipping. Flatweave rugs are thin and packable but may not provide enough cushion for standing for long periods.

FAQ

Can I machine wash a 10-foot round rug at home?
Most standard home washing machines cannot accommodate a 10-foot diameter rug — the drum is simply too small. Washable rugs in this size, like the LOONGRUG, kakania, and WITSHOCK, are designed for commercial laundromat machines. Always check the manufacturer’s washing instructions before attempting to clean a large rug at home, and be prepared to transport the rug to a laundromat with oversized washer capacity.
How long does it take for a folded 10-foot round rug to lay flat?
Thin polyester washable rugs (0.24 to 0.25 inches) typically flatten within 24 hours when placed on the floor and lightly weighted at the corners with books. Braided cotton rugs like the GRUHUM may require 2 to 3 weeks for deep creases to relax fully. Using a hair dryer on medium heat from the center outward can accelerate the process for all rug types — most owners report 15 to 20 minutes achieves 90 to 95 percent flattening.
Do I need a rug pad under a 10-foot round carpet?
It depends entirely on the backing material. Rugs with rubber or TPR backings (SAFAVIEH Amelia, LOONGRUG, kakania, WITSHOCK) grip hard floors effectively without a pad. Rugs with jute or cotton backings (Unique Loom Tekke, Keen Home Design Skies, GRUHUM) benefit significantly from a rug pad on hardwood, tile, or laminate to prevent sliding and protect the floor finish. Outdoor rugs with no backing (Rugs.com Aztec) often need tape or a pad on smooth outdoor surfaces.
Will a 10-foot round rug fit under a dining table with chairs?
Yes, but the pile height matters more than the diameter. Low-pile rugs (under 0.3 inches) allow dining chairs to slide in and out without catching. Mid-pile rugs (0.3 to 0.5 inches) work if the table legs have wide feet that distribute weight. High-pile shag rugs (over 1 inch) are not recommended under dining tables — chair legs will dig into the fibers constantly, creating permanent matting and making the rug difficult to clean.
Which 10-foot round rug is best for robot vacuums?
Robot vacuums work best with rugs that have a pile height of 0.3 inches or less and a thin edge profile that the robot can climb. The Rugs.com Outdoor Aztec (0.16 inches), WITSHOCK (0.24 inches), LOONGRUG (0.25 inches), and kakania (0.25 inches) all pass the robot vacuum test easily. The SAFAVIEH Amelia (0.43 inches) is borderline — most robots can climb it but may struggle if the edge is curled. The SAFAVIEH Horizon Shag (2.56 inches) is not compatible with any robot vacuum.
